    The affected body parts
    To be precise, smoking harms nearly all the organs of your body and reduces your health in general. However, some of the most affected areas are lung, throat and heart. The tar build-up in the lungs and in the throat can cause cancer and makes breathing very difficult. Owing to the smoking, the normal oxygen level in the body diminishes and the heart has to overwork to supply the required amount. Thus, the heart rate of a smoker is much faster than that of a non-smoker.

    Among young people, the health effects of smoking are more severe owing to the fact that their bodies are exposed to a mixture of 4000 chemicals (contained in one cigarette) at a tender age. Smoking also reduces one’s life span. A smoker lives a decade less than a non-smoker.

    One of the most adverse health effects of smoking is the enhanced risk of lung cancer. Not only lung, but also your smoking habit could leads to other cancers including lip, oral, pharynx, esophagus, larynx, pancreas, cervix, bladder, and even kidney. The effects of smoking on the body can also include emphysema, heart attack, underweight newborn children, miscarriage, stroke, cataracts, and impotence.

    Additional risk
    Smoking often leads to other destructive habits like drinking, unprotected sex, drugs, etc. This aside, smokers have a hard time healing from surgeries and they have lower survival rate after surgery compared to non-smokers. Post surgery complications (like wound infection, post operation pneumonia, respiratory complications, etc.) are also more probable in case of a cigarette smoking man/ lady. Greater chances of suffering from periodontitis (a gum disease leading to teeth and bone loss) and peptic ulcer are also counted among adverse health effects of smoking.

    However, the only good thing is that, when a person quits smoking the body begins to mend much of the damage that has been caused and the smokers’ probability of developing certain types of cancer and illnesses associated with smoking is greatly reduced.

    Everyone alive is affected by stress and anxiety from such things as work, relationships, money, diet and loneliness. Even if you do not have anything to stress about you may create something. This type of a stress can lead to health issues over the long-term as your body breaks down.

    However, if the stress is not long-term, then more than likely you will not have any health issues because of it. The first signs could be that of an ulcer or a colitis attack. Other symptoms of stress overload include digestive and intestinal problems. Stress can also lead to high blood pressure, irritability, headaches, diarrhea, neck aches, dizziness and loss of appetite.

  • Health and Safety

    Health and safety are things that go hand-in-hand, even when you are dealing with a baby. This is especially true whenever it comes to preventing your baby from drowning within your home.
    Of course, a lot of the tips that have to do with this health and safety issue are common sense. Nevertheless, you should still be reminded of these things. So, here they are:

    1.You should never leave a baby alone in the bathtub even for a moment. You should also not allow a young child to take care of your baby without being in the same room.

    2.You should never consider your baby’s bath seat to substitute for you being present because this is an aid, not a safety item. It is also important for you not to use this item in a non-skid, slip-resistant bathtub because the suction cups cannot adhere to the bathtub’s surface.

    3.You should never leave a bucket with liquid in it unattended, regardless as to whether you are outside or inside. Instead, make sure that they are placed wherever they cannot be reached whenever they are not in use.

    4.You should make sure that there are safety covers and barriers in place to keep your baby from getting into a spa or hot tub whenever you are not using them. It is recommended that you do not use a non-rigid solar cover as a baby can still slip through there.

    5.You should always keep your toilet’s lid down. You may even want to put a latch on your bathroom door so that your baby cannot get in there without you.

    Another important health and safety point here is to learn CPR. This can save your baby’s life whenever you only have seconds on your side. If you know anyone else who has a baby, make sure that you share these tips to health and safety with them as well.

    The Alberta health care system has a very positive ambiance. The provincial government has been providing the funds to ensure that the programs, technology and facilities are of standard. The funding and legislation of the Alberta Health and Wellness requires more than a third of the provincial government budget.

    In the year 2005, the Alberta Health and Wellness had received more than $700 million in its programs. This huge sum of money had made a great difference to the Alberta health care system in the province. In the year 2006, an Alberta Children’s Hospital has been newly opened, having 129 beds and with the capacity to accommodate 60,000 visits each year. Two more hospitals are presently under construction and are scheduled to be operative in 2007 and 2008.

    Alberta is also investing in medical research and the Alberta Research Council in Canada is providing the research, advisory and development services. The Alberta Cancer Board manages the cancer research, treatment, prevention and education programs in Alberta.

    The health care benefits
    The Alberta health care system has incorporated medical technologies like ultra sound scanners and CT. The province has nine regions for managing the delivery of health care in hospitals, community health services, continuing care facilities and public health.
